انگلیسیفرانسویاسپانیایی

Ad


فاویکون OnWorks

alienp - آنلاین در ابر

اجرای alienp در ارائه دهنده هاست رایگان OnWorks از طریق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S

این دستور alienp است که می تواند در ارائه دهنده هاست رایگان OnWorks با استفاده از یکی از چندین ایستگاه کاری آنلاین رایگان مانند Ubuntu Online، Fedora Online، شبیه ساز آنلاین ویندوز یا شبیه ساز آنلاین MAC OS اجرا شود.

برنامه:

نام


alien - یک بسته باینری بیگانه را تبدیل یا نصب کنید

خلاصه


بیگانه [--to-deb] [--to-rpm] [--to-tgz] [--to-slp] [گزینه ها] فایل [...]

شرح


بیگانه برنامه ای است که بین Red Hat rpm، Debian deb، Stampede slp، Slackware تبدیل می کند.
فرمت های فایل tgz و Solaris pkg. اگر می خواهید از بسته ای از یک لینوکس دیگر استفاده کنید
از توزیعی که روی سیستم خود نصب کرده اید، می توانید استفاده کنید بیگانه برای تبدیل
آن را در قالب بسته دلخواه خود و نصب کنید. همچنین از بسته های LSB پشتیبانی می کند.

هشدار


بیگانه نباید برای جایگزینی بسته های مهم سیستم مانند init، libc یا موارد دیگر استفاده شود
مواردی که برای عملکرد سیستم شما ضروری است. بسیاری از این بسته ها هستند
توسط توزیع‌های مختلف و بسته‌های مختلف، متفاوت تنظیم می‌شوند
توزیع ها را نمی توان به جای یکدیگر استفاده کرد. به طور کلی، اگر نمی توانید یک بسته را حذف کنید
بدون اینکه سیستم خود را خراب کنید، سعی نکنید آن را با یک نسخه بیگانه جایگزین کنید.

بسته FORMAT NOTES


rpm برای تبدیل و تبدیل به فرمت rpm باید Red Hat Package Manager نصب شده باشد.

lsb بر خلاف سایر فرمت های بسته، بیگانه می تواند وابستگی های بسته های lsb را کنترل کند
اگر قالب بسته مقصد از وابستگی ها پشتیبانی کند. توجه داشته باشید که این بدان معناست که
بسته تولید شده از یک بسته lsb به بسته ای به نام "lsb" بستگی دارد - شما
توزیع باید بسته ای با آن نام ارائه دهد، اگر با lsb سازگار باشد. در
اسکریپت های بسته lsb نیز به صورت پیش فرض تبدیل می شوند.

برای تولید بسته های lsb، Red Hat Package Manager باید نصب شود، و بیگانه
اگر برنامه ای به نام lsb-rpm وجود داشته باشد، بر اساس اولویت استفاده خواهد کرد. هیچ تضمینی داده نمی شود
بسته‌های lsb تولید شده کاملاً با LSB سازگار خواهند بود و بعید است
آنها را خواهند ساخت مگر اینکه آنها را در محیط lsbdev بسازید.

توجه داشته باشید که بر خلاف سایر فرمت های بسته، تبدیل یک بسته LSB به فرمت دیگر
باعث نمی شود که شماره نسخه جزئی آن تغییر کند.

deb برای تبدیل به (اما نه از) فرمت deb، gcc، make، debhelper، dpkg-dev، و
بسته های dpkg باید نصب شوند.

tgz توجه داشته باشید که هنگام تبدیل از فرمت tgz، بیگانه به سادگی یک خروجی تولید خواهد کرد
بسته ای که همان فایل های موجود در فایل tgz را در خود دارد. این فقط در صورتی کار می کند که
فایل tgz دارای باینری های از پیش کامپایل شده در درخت دایرکتوری لینوکس استاندارد است. انجام ندهید
اجرا بیگانه روی فایل‌های tar با کد منبع در آنها، مگر اینکه بخواهید این کد منبع را داشته باشید
در هنگام نصب بسته در دایرکتوری ریشه خود نصب شود!

هنگام استفاده از بیگانه برای تبدیل یک بسته tgz، همه فایل ها در /و غیره در فرض می شود
فایل های پیکربندی

pkg برای دستکاری بسته ها در فرمت Solaris pkg (که در واقع جریان داده SV است
قالب بسته)، به ابزارهای Solaris pkginfo و pkgtrans نیاز دارید.

OPTIONS


بیگانه تمام فایل هایی را که به آن ارسال می کنید به همه انواع خروجی که مشخص کرده اید تبدیل می کند.
اگر نوع خروجی مشخص نشده باشد، به طور پیش فرض به فرمت deb تبدیل می شود.

فایل [...]
لیست فایل های بسته برای تبدیل.

-d, ---to-deb
بسته های دبیان بسازید. این پیش فرض است.

-r, -- به دور در دقیقه
بسته های دور در دقیقه بسازید.

-t, --to-tgz
بسته های tgz بسازید.

--to-slp
بسته های slp بسازید.

-p, --به-pkg
بسته های pkg سولاریس را بسازید.

-i, --نصب
هر بسته تولید شده را به صورت خودکار نصب کنید و پس از نصب فایل بسته را حذف کنید
نصب شده است.

-g, --تولید می کنند
یک دایرکتوری موقت مناسب برای ساختن یک بسته از آن ایجاد کنید، اما این کار را نکنید
در واقع بسته را ایجاد کنید. اگر می‌خواهید فایل‌ها را در اطراف جابجا کنید، این کار مفید است
بسته بندی قبل از ساخت آن بسته را می توان از این دایرکتوری موقت توسط
اگر در حال ایجاد یک بسته دبیان یا با اجرای «دبیان/قوانین باینری» هستید
"rpmbuild -bb spec.» اگر در حال ایجاد یک بسته Red Hat بودید.

-s, --تنها
پسندیدن -g، اما دایرکتوری packagename.orig را تولید نکنید. این فقط زمانی مفید است که
فضای دیسک شما بسیار کم است و در حال تولید یک بسته دبیان هستید.

-c, -- اسکریپت ها
سعی کنید اسکریپت هایی که قرار است در هنگام نصب بسته اجرا شوند را تبدیل کنید و
حذف شده. از این با احتیاط استفاده کنید، زیرا این اسکریپت ها ممکن است برای کار بر روی یک طراحی شده باشند
سیستم بر خلاف سیستم شما، و می تواند باعث ایجاد مشکل شود. توصیه می شود معاینه کنید
قبل از استفاده از این گزینه، اسکریپت ها را با دست بررسی کنید و ببینید چه کاری انجام می دهند.

این به طور پیش فرض هنگام تبدیل از بسته های lsb فعال است.

--patch=وصله
به جای جستجوی خودکار وصله در داخل، پچ مورد استفاده را مشخص کنید
/var/lib/alien. این هیچ تاثیری ندارد مگر اینکه بسته دبیان ساخته شود.

-- هر پچ
در مورد اینکه کدام فایل وصله استفاده می شود، کمتر سخت گیری کنید، شاید سعی کنید از یک فایل وصله استفاده کنید
برای نسخه قدیمی بسته. این تضمینی نیست که همیشه کار کند. مسن تر
ممکن است وصله ها لزوما با بسته های جدیدتر کار نکنند.

--نمی رسد
از هیچ فایل پچ استفاده نکنید.

--شرح=نزولی
توضیحاتی برای بسته بندی مشخص کنید. این فقط هنگام تبدیل از تأثیر می گذارد
قالب بسته tgz که فاقد توضیحات است.

--نسخه=نسخه
یک نسخه برای بسته مشخص کنید. این فقط در هنگام تبدیل از
قالب بسته tgz، که ممکن است فاقد اطلاعات نسخه باشد.

توجه داشته باشید که بدون آرگومان، این نسخه نسخه را نمایش می دهد بیگانه به جای آن.

-T, --تست
بسته های تولید شده را تست کنید. در حال حاضر این فقط برای بسته‌های دبیان پشتیبانی می‌شود،
که در صورت نصب lintian با lintian و خروجی lintian تست می شود.
نمایش داده.

-k, --keep-نسخه
به طور پیش فرض، بیگانه به شماره نسخه فرعی هر بسته ای که تبدیل می کند یک عدد اضافه می کند. اگر
این گزینه داده شده است، بیگانه این کار را نخواهد کرد.

-- ضربه =عدد
به جای اینکه شماره نسخه بسته تبدیل شده را 1 افزایش دهید، آن را افزایش دهید
با عدد داده شده

--fixperms
هنگام ساختن یک deb، همه صاحبان فایل و مجوزها را پاکسازی کنید. این ممکن است مفید باشد اگر
بسته اصلی بهم ریخته است. از سوی دیگر، ممکن است برخی چیزها را به هم بزند
با مجوزها و صاحبان آنها تا حدی که این کار را انجام می دهد، بنابراین به طور پیش فرض خاموش است. این
فقط هنگام تبدیل به بسته های دبیان قابل استفاده است.

--target=معماری
معماری بسته تولید شده را به رشته داده شده تحمیل کنید.

-v, -- پرحرف
پرحرف باشید: هر دستور را نمایش دهید بیگانه در فرآیند تبدیل یک بسته اجرا می شود.

-- بسیار پرحرف
مانند --verbose پرمخاطب باشید، اما خروجی هر دستور اجرا شده را نیز نمایش دهید. مقداری
دستورات ممکن است خروجی زیادی تولید کنند.

-h, --کمک
نمایش خلاصه استفاده کوتاه

-V, - نسخه
نمایش نسخه از بیگانه.

مثال ها


در اینجا چند نمونه از استفاده از بیگانه:

بیگانه --to-deb package.rpm
بسته.rpm را به package.deb تبدیل کنید

بیگانه --to-rpm package.deb
بسته.deb را به package.rpm تبدیل کنید

alien -i package.rpm
بسته.rpm را به package.deb تبدیل کنید (تبدیل به بسته .deb پیش فرض است،
بنابراین نیازی نیست --to-deb را مشخص کنید)، و بسته تولید شده را نصب کنید.

بیگانه --to-deb --to-rpm --to-tgz --to-slp foo.deb bar.rpm baz.tgz
9 بسته جدید ایجاد می کند. پس از اتمام، فو بار و باز در هر 4 دستگاه موجود است
فرمت های بسته

محیط زیست


بیگانه متغیرهای محیطی زیر را تشخیص می دهد:

RPMBUILDOPT
گزینه هایی برای انتقال به دور در دقیقه هنگام ساخت یک بسته.

RPMINSTALLOPT
گزینه هایی برای انتقال به rpm هنگام نصب بسته.

EMAIL
اگر تنظیم شود، بیگانه فرض می کند این آدرس ایمیل شماست. آدرس های ایمیل در آن گنجانده شده است
بسته های دبیان تولید کرد.

از alienp به صورت آنلاین با استفاده از خدمات onworks.net استفاده کنید


سرورها و ایستگاه های کاری رایگان

دانلود برنامه های ویندوز و لینوکس

  • 1
    بسیار تمیز
    بسیار تمیز
    یک اسکریپت کاتلین که تمام ساخت‌ها را هسته‌ای می‌کند
    حافظه پنهان از پروژه های Gradle/Android.
    زمانی مفید است که Gradle یا IDE به شما اجازه دهند
    پایین. اسکریپت روی تست شده است
    macOS، اما ...
    دانلود عمیق تمیز
  • 2
    پلاگین Eclipse Checkstyle
    پلاگین Eclipse Checkstyle
    پلاگین Eclipse Checkstyle
    کد جاوا Checkstyle را یکپارچه می کند
    حسابرس به Eclipse IDE. در
    پلاگین بازخورد در زمان واقعی را به شما ارائه می دهد
    کاربر در مورد viol...
    دانلود Eclipse Checkstyle Plug-in
  • 3
    AstrOrzPlayer
    AstrOrzPlayer
    AstrOrz Player یک پخش کننده رسانه رایگان است
    نرم افزار، بخشی مبتنی بر WMP و VLC. این
    پخش کننده به سبک مینیمالیستی است، با
    بیش از ده رنگ تم، و همچنین می توانید
    ب ...
    AstrOrzPlayer را دانلود کنید
  • 4
    movistartv
    movistartv
    Kodi Movistar+ TV بدون ADDON برای XBMC/
    Kodi que Permite disponer de un
    رمزگشایی خدمات IPTV
    Movistar integrado en uno de los
    مراکز رسانه ای ما...
    دانلود movistartv
  • 5
    کد :: بلوک
    کد :: بلوک
    کد::Blocks یک منبع باز و رایگان است،
    کراس پلتفرم C، C++ و Fortran IDE
    ساخته شده برای پاسخگویی به بیشترین نیازها
    از کاربران آن بسیار طراحی شده است
    تمدید می کند ...
    کد دانلود::Blocks
  • 6
    در میان
    در میان
    در میان یا رابط پیشرفته Minecraft
    و Data/Structure Tracking ابزاری برای
    نمای کلی یک Minecraft را نمایش دهید
    جهان، بدون اینکه واقعاً آن را ایجاد کند. آی تی
    می توان ...
    دانلود در میان
  • بیشتر "

دستورات لینوکس

Ad